Correction to: Health Care Transition Planning Among Youth with ASD and Other Mental, Behavioral, and Developmental
Benjamin Zablotsky1, Jessica Rast2, Matthew D Bramlett3
1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, National Center for Health Statistics, 3311 Toledo Road, Hyattsville, MD, 20782, USA. bzablotsky@cdc.gov.
Abstract:
In the original publication of the article, Figure 1 included footnotes which duplicated information appearing in the figure caption. Therefore the notes of "NOTES: ASD = autism spectrum disorder; MBDD = mental, behavioral, or developmental disorder. Indicators presented are unadjusted estimates. x Significantly different than youth with autism spectrum disorder based on adjusted odds ratio (p < .05). y Significantly different than youth with other mental, behavioral, or developmental disorders based on adjusted odds ratio (p < .05)." have been removed. The figure 1 appearing in the original version of the article has been corrected.

Specialized Care Centers and Settings-II
Rural health centers are specialized care facilities in remote locations with very few medical personnel. The primary care providers who run the centers are mostly Registered Nurse Practitioners. Here, emergency treatment is provided to critically ill or injured patients before they are transferred to the closest hospital.
